Output 8b5ddd66b2069065ebd3f67322183a6affd3fadb2f60ed161ebcc3e77e492790:0

value
502113045
script pubkey
OP_0 OP_PUSHBYTES_20 bf3eba08a7813b8622e21a445c977e5745de1bba
address
bc1qhult5z98syacvghzrfz9e9m72azauxa6xkhfz9
transaction
8b5ddd66b2069065ebd3f67322183a6affd3fadb2f60ed161ebcc3e77e492790
spent
true